About this property

Great Place to Get Away to!

This cabin is very cozy, nicely decorated and feels like a dream mountain retreat. This is a beautiful and wonderful remote spot in the Idaho Mountains with fishing, snowmobiling, hiking and quading just waiting for you to expierience it. Anderson Ranch Reservoir is a few miles down the road with boating, fishing and swimming. There are also nature's hot pots (Baumgartner Hot Springs is up the road a bit and hot springs are also located along the river by the Johnson Bridge.
The outdoor fire pit is waiting for you to roast marshmallows and cook hot dogs. Roasting sticks are in the cabin. Maybe you'll be lucky and a beautiful buck or doe will come to see what you are up to. At dawn and dusk sometimes Deer and Elk wander by the cabin. It's fun to watch all of nature just out the front door.
In the winter there are miles and miles of groomed snowmobile trails. You can drive in and snowmobile out from our cabin. You can snowmobile north to Rocky Bar (a ghost town) and then head towards Atlanta or loop back past the Trinity Lakes at 9,000 ft in elevation. So many sites are breathtaking and a beauty to behold no matter the season. It's a wonderful place to use your photography skills and take family pictures to treasure forever.
If you don't have the 'toys' (i.e. quads, motorcycles, boats, wave runners, etc) there are many things to do and see close to home or if you like to explore further you can drive up past Rocky Bar to Atlanta or to the Trinity Lakes - or take a drive through the mountains to Sun Valley or Boise via the back roads. Try your luck at panning for gold in the rivers if you want to or have a picnic under the soft pines near the mountains and lakes.
